“Call” Set to Be Received

British television network ITV has scheduled its four-part adaptation of The Long Call, Ann Cleeves’ first Detective Inspector Venn novel (published in 2019). It will premiere on Monday, October 25, and run till the 28th. Here’s The Killing Times’ thumbnail of the plot:
Matthew was brought up in the Barum Brethren before leaving to go to University. At 19 he knew he couldn’t continue amongst the [religious] community and to his mother’s shock and dismay, he declared publicly he no longer believed. Now he’s back, not just to grieve for his father, but to lead a shocking murder investigation back where it all began for him.
The Long Call, we’re told, is set “in a small community in North Devon [where Venn lives] with his husband, Jonathan.” There’s no word yet on when this program might become available to U.S. audiences.

Meanwhile, the same source alerts us that “Filming has begun on the third series of ITV crime drama McDonald & Dodds starring Tala Gouveia and Jason Watkins … The four-part series starts with ‘Belvedere,’ where a young woman is found dead sitting in a deckchair in broad daylight in one of Bath’s most beautiful and populated parks. Why did this woman die with a smile on her face?”

McDonald & Dodds’ return is expected sometime in 2022.
